Drivers car
A fine car for a short trip. Excellent stability. Ride a bit firm and tire are noisy. Gas milage, 24 city and 32 country at 75mph. 3 years - no mechanical problems.

Nice M
The car is a hoot to drive and turns heads. The paint on the front hood tends to get beat up with rocks, especially the black color. The resale value of these cars fell quite a bit in the past few years. I love the car - replace the dunlops with Khumos - much better. Every option is nice and the hardtop is very quiet.
